## Releases

Build timestamps come from the agents themselves, and the Corvel fleet drifts. Keep skew under 5 seconds or the Tansy scheduler will reorder artifacts and break reproducibility checks. Run the sync script before tagging a release. All tagged builds must be signed before upload to the Dunmere registry. The active signing key is listed below.

rollout seal: bky4_DFM9

Ticket: the Harpwell credentials vault locked itself again after three bad attempts, and the CSV import wizard can't fetch its column-mapping templates without it. Future maintainers: don't reset the vault — just unseal it and the wizard recovers on its own. For posterity, the unseal passphrase is recorded directly below.

strongbox words: fraath-isteth

Handover: Paylark integration tests. Welcome aboard — the flaky suite is mostly in the settlement retry path. Tests fail when the mock ledger at Corvane lags past 2s; rerun usually passes. Don't bump timeouts blindly; Marisol tried that and masked a real race in the dedupe worker. Quarantine list lives in the repo root. To restore the staging vault used by the fixtures, you'll need the recovery passphrase, which is:

strongbox words: novwyn-julvan-weniel-jorax-sorix-pelath-druwyn-druok-soreth

## Runbook: Seat-Map Renderer (Proscenia)

The Proscenia seat-map renderer converts venue layout files into interactive SVG grids for the Gildhall Theatre booking flow. Plugin authors should validate layouts against the schema endpoint before submission; malformed tier definitions will render as blank sections rather than failing loudly. Rate limits apply per plugin, not per venue. All render and validation calls must authenticate against the internal render gateway using the key below.

API key for tagug-tajef: vxb4-R1fo